hyperspyui.plugins.align module

class hyperspyui.plugins.align.AlignPlugin(main_window)

Bases: hyperspyui.plugins.plugin.Plugin

_align_along_axis(roi, signal, axis)
_get_signal(signal)
static _smooth(y, box_pts)
align_1D(roi, signal=None)
align_2D(roi, signal=None)
align_XD(roi, signal=None)
align_horizontal(roi, signal=None)
align_vertical(roi, signal=None)
create_actions()
create_menu()
create_toolbars()
create_tools()
manual_align(signal=None)
name = 'Align'
class hyperspyui.plugins.align.ManualAlignDialog(signal, parent=None)

Bases: hyperspyui.widgets.extendedqwidgets.ExToolWindow

cancel()
close(self) bool
create_controls()
ok()

Callback when dialog is closed by OK-button.

update_x()
update_y()